Notable Surf Albums Inspired by Bali

While pinpointing specific commercially released “surf albums Bali” can be tricky (much of the music is released as singles or EPs), many compilations and individual artist albums capture the vibe. Here are some examples, or artists who embody that feeling:

  • Dialog Dini Hari: Though not strictly a “surf album,” their laid-back acoustic vibes and lyrics often evoke the feeling of a sunset session at Uluwatu. Their album “Luka, Cita” is a great example.
  • Navicula: Known for their environmental activism and blend of rock and reggae, Navicula’s music resonates with the conscious surfer. Their albums often touch on themes of ocean conservation and the importance of protecting Bali’s natural beauty.
  • Various Artists – Bali Lounge Compilations: While not exclusively surf-themed, these compilations often feature tracks that capture the chill, beachside atmosphere of Bali. They are perfect for relaxing after a long day of surfing.

These examples highlight the diverse range of musical styles that have been influenced by Bali’s surf culture. While dedicated “surf albums Bali” might be less common than singles or EPs, the spirit of surfing is undeniably present in much of the island’s music.

Finding the Perfect Soundtrack for Your Bali Surf Trip

Whether you’re planning a surf trip to Bali or simply want to experience the island’s surf culture from afar, exploring the local music scene is a great way to immerse yourself in the Balinese experience. There are several ways to discover surf albums Bali and find the perfect soundtrack for your adventure:

  • Online Streaming Platforms: Spotify, Apple Music, and other streaming platforms offer a vast library of Balinese music, including many surf-inspired tracks. Search for keywords such as “Bali surf music,” “Balinese reggae,” or “Indonesian acoustic” to discover new artists and albums.
  • Local Music Stores: If you’re in Bali, visit local music stores and ask for recommendations. The staff are often knowledgeable about the local music scene and can point you towards hidden gems.
  • Live Music Venues: Attend live music performances at bars and clubs in Bali. This is a great way to discover new artists and experience the energy of the local music scene firsthand.
